'Despite double-engine govt, what has Bihar gained?': Tejashwi Yadav launches fresh attack on Nitish Kumar

RJD leader Tejashwi Yadav criticized the Nitish Kumar government for its handling of protesting BPSC aspirants and the state's overall condition. Yadav highlighted issues like unemployment, poverty, and rising electricity bills, promising relief if elected. He questioned the 'double-engine government's' achievements and the Chief Minister's upcoming yatra, emphasizing the need to address student concerns.
